OklahomaHB 4420Oklahoma 2026 Regular SessionHouse

Strong Readers Act; references; legislative findings; reading screenings; reading intervention plans; reading deficiencies; mandatory third grade retention; good cause exemptions; request process; intensive reading intervention; acceleration class; reporting requirements; summer academy programs; teacher training requirements; literacy instructional team; revolving fund; donations; emergency.

Sponsored By: Kyle Hilbert (Republican)
